2 blocks of houses (Nos 131 to 161, and Nos 181 to 193) separated by
Orchard Avenue. Small early C19 houses similar to those of Franklin
Place and also in very smart condition. 2 storeys and attic; slate
roofs; 1 dormer each. Stuccoed. 1 window each. Sash windows in
reveals in flat arches; glazing bars intact except in ground floor
windows of Nos 181, 191 and 193. No 185 has a small projecting early
C19 shop window on ground floor with glazing bars intact. Nos 131 to
157 have doorways with flat arches; Nos 161 and 181 to 193 have
elliptical arched doorways; doors in reveals behind. Some doors
modern; some with 6 flush panels. Doorways flanked by pilasters with
projecting cornices over.
